Kumasi Asante Kotoko would be seeking to consolidate their position as league leaders when they play away to Fetteh Feyenoord in match-day-VI at the Swedru Park.
The Porcupine Warriors leapfrogged AshantiGold to the summit of the league standings for the first time this season after a lone goal victory over Sekondi Hasaacas in their outstanding clash at the Gyandu Park on Sunday.
But the table toppers would find a tough opposition in Fetteh Feyenoord, who have suffered a horrible start in this season’s OneTouch Premier League campaign.
They are yet to win a match after the opening four games which firmly lock them place up from the bottom of the league table.
Fetteh Feyenoord would hope to record their first win on Wednesday when they welcome Asante Kotoko to their home grounds.
At the Len Clay stadium, AshantiGold will try to keep the heat on Kotoko when they play Liberty Professionals.
The Miners playing at home are faced with a daunting task, even though they have an impressive home record of two wins at their Len Clay grounds so far in the league.
Heart of Lions playing at home welcome Gamba All Blacks in match-day-VI.
Heart of Lions have experienced unpleasant runs in the season after their opening day flyer when they beat Power FC 3-0 at home.
The Lions have since that game lost three successive matches. They would attempt to devour Gamba All Blacks in their den at the Kpando Stadium.
At the Tema Park, Accra Hearts of Oak play as guest to Real Sportive.
The Phobians though tipped to carry the day but might share the spoils with Sportive.
Troubled King Faisal, currently propping the sixteen club table after they were docked six points for fielding an unqualified player on match-day-I play at home to Berekum Arsenals at the Sunyani Coronation Park.
King Faisal, who earlier this week lost CEO, George Amoako to Asante Kotoko, now have a point deficit of minus one.
The Kumasi-based side would try to redeem their point shortfall with victory over Arsenals. Sekondi Hasaacas after their loss to Kotoko on Sunday would try give their fans some glimmer of hope when they play Real Tamale United at the Gyandu Park.
Real Tamale United who haven’t been impressive in the league might try to pluck a point from Gyandu. Great Olympics would attempt to collect al three points in their tie against Tano Bofoakwa at the Ho Stadium.
On Thursday, Tema Youth and Power FC will battle for honours at the Tema Stadium.
